Abstract

The article focuses on a study which examined the impact of using paper mill sludge (PMS) for surface-mine reclamation on runoff water quality and plant growth. The PMS sample was analyzed for solids content, total nitrogen (N), total carbon (C) inorganic C, nitrate-nitrogen, ammonium-nitrogen, and major elements. The chemical properties of the runoff were described. It was observed that the application of PMS at both rates greatly reduced runoff and erosion from the plots, particularly during the 2.5-mo Pre-Plant period when the control plots were bare.
